About Greg

Greg McGee, CFP®, is a Vice President and Investment Associate at J.P. Morgan Wealth Management.

Greg is a member of The Hill Group, a team of highly experienced investment and wealth planning professionals who provide financial guidance to a select number of executives, founders and foundations. He leverages the breadth of J.P. Morgan's extensive platform to customize appropriate strategies for specific client needs.

With over 10 years of experience in financial services, Greg began his career with Brown Brothers Harriman in Boston and joined J.P. Morgan in 2013. He earned his M.B.A. with High Honors from Boston University and holds a B.A. in Political Science and Spanish from Boston College.

Greg currently lives in Arlington, Massachusetts, with his wife and two young children. Outside of work, he enjoys spending time with family and friends, traveling, and trying new restaurants in Boston.

He holds FINRA Series 7 and 66 securities licenses.
